The Queen has agreed a "period of transition" in which the Duke and Duchess of Sussex will spend time in Canada and the UK; we speak to the head of Human Rights Watch who says he's been denied entry into Hong Kong where he was expected to present a paper critical of China's growing global influence; and a volcano in the Philippines has begun spewing lava, as authorities warn that a "hazardous eruption" is possible "within hours or days".
